- Chronic total occlusion percutaneous intervention is becoming a more common technique with higher success rates. These success rates can be at least partially attributed to the use of classical and contemporary imaging modalities. Preprocedural preparation including patient selection and detailed coronary imaging with the use of computerized tomography are helpful to ensure the highest chance of success. Procedural utilization of intravascular ultrasound and optical coherence tomography are additional tools to help facilitate success during difficult cases. Minimally invasive imaging modalities help determine improvement of left ventricular function or the presence of continued ischemia in the postprocedural period. Newer techniques including high-definition computerized tomography scanners can accurately show details of stent morphology and the presence of in-stent restenosis without the need of a further procedure. Invasive imaging including the use of intravascular ultrasound and optical coherence tomography can highlight the cause of in-stent restenosis and its treatment. Future development and progression of these and other imaging techniques will help the a chronic total occlusion percutaneous intervention operator further improve procedural success and long-term clinical outcome.
